[0004] In actual production and life, if the wastewater that needs to be treated in the laboratory is complex, there are many types, and the amount of wastewater is also irregular. In the existing laboratory wastewater treatment equipment, inorganic wastewater or organic wastewater or biochemical wastewater is generally treated separately. It is impossible to conduct centralized and thorough treatment of laboratory comprehensive wastewater, and the treatment effect is not ideal

[0038] As shown in the figure, the working process and working principle of the embodiment of the present invention: the waste water first enters the comprehensive waste water collection and pre-precipitation device 1, and the pH value online monitoring instrument 16 in the device detects the pH value of the waste water and transmits the data to the central processing unit. The processor turns on the metering pump 15 according to the detection result and adds the corresponding acid and alkali from the dosing box 12, and the pH value of the waste water is adjusted through the acid-base neutralization reaction, and a part of precipitation is formed at the same time. The invention discloses a laboratory comprehensive waste water centralization treatment apparatus capable of comprehensively treating comprehensive waste water containing organic components, inorganic components and biochemistry components. The apparatus comprises a central processor and a waste water centralization treatment unit. The waste water centralization treatment unit comprises a comprehensive waste water collection and pre-precipitation device, a novel catalytic activity micro electrolysis treatment device, a comprehensive waste water centralization reaction precipitation treatment device, a filtration precipitate separation device, a high-low electric potential difference micro electrolysis system, an electrochemical catalytic oxidation reduction treatment system, a two-level organic biological membrane purification system, an ozone sterilizer, a MBR membrane bioreactor, and a terminal acid alkali neutralization unit, wherein all the devices are sequentially communicated. Waste water is sequentially treated by the devices so as to achieve a comprehensive waste water treatment effect. According to the present invention, according to components of different experimental waste water, different treatment technologies and control systems are adopted to carry out a waste water treatment, characteristics of small occupation area, high automation degree, good treatment effect and the like are provided, and the apparatus is widely used for treatments of comprehensive waste water containing organic components, inorganic components and biochemistry components in colleges and universities, research institutes, hospitals, biological pharmacy, disease control, enterprises, and other fields.

technical field [0001] The invention relates to a waste water treatment device, in particular to a laboratory comprehensive waste water centralized treatment device which can comprehensively treat organic, inorganic and biochemical waste water. Background technique [0002] With the development of science and technology in China, the demand for laboratories is increasing, especially in the past ten years, the number of various laboratory constructions has continued to increase. From the perspective of the distribution of laboratories, they are mainly concentrated in middle and high schools, scientific research institutes, medical institutions, biopharmaceuticals, disease control, environmental supervision, product quality inspection, drug inspection, blood stations, animal husbandry, hospitals, enterprises and other industries , the area is scattered, the discharge of wastewater is not large, and its pollution is easy to be ignored.
